Output edb56ccb233aff17e06390dceaada6a31259350b31ecfeb72780d49fa48daf95:0

value
42225663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bae7bf1f3ba3ef343953c37ae8540ee9d3562a3 OP_EQUAL
address
MBt8K3uXj144WJT5fTMA6hogHm4nmxa2r4
transaction
edb56ccb233aff17e06390dceaada6a31259350b31ecfeb72780d49fa48daf95
spent
true